What is the difference between Software Engineer Two vs Software Engineer Three?

AspectSoftware Engineer TwoSoftware Engineer Three
Required CredentialsBachelor's degree in Computer Science or related field; 2+ years experienceBachelor's degree; 3+ years experience; often some certifications
Work EnvironmentCollaborative team projects, coding, debuggingSimilar environment, more complex projects, mentorship roles
Employer & Industry UsageCommon in tech companies, startups, software firmsSame as Software Engineer Two, often a step above in responsibility
Search & Comparison IntentPeople comparing mid-level software engineering rolesLooking for progression or differentiation in software engineering levels

The main difference between Software Engineer Two and Software Engineer Three lies in experience and responsibility. Software Engineer Three typically has more years of experience, handles more complex tasks, and may mentor junior staff. Both roles are common in tech industries, with Software Engineer Three representing a higher level of expertise and responsibility.

Job description

Quality Engineer II Status: Exempt (salaried) Department: Quality Position Summary The Quality Engineer II is a vital team member that supports activities related to the development and continual operation of Plug Power’s products. The Quality Engineer II will drive continuous quality improvement through development and use of a customized QMS, KPIs, effective root cause analysis and problem resolution. Enabling optimized decision making by focusing on risk reduction and defect prevention. The position will also be responsible for product environmental, safety and regulatory compliance. The role also requires close interaction with the supply chain, Engineering, manufacturing and other cross‑functional departments to ensure that designs meet all cross‑functional requirements.

Core Duties and Responsibilities

Ensures compliance to all Regulatory (Local, Federal, International), Corporate, and Plant standards. Work to thoroughly understand Plug Power’s projects including but not limited to relevant codes & standards, hydrogen production technology, customer site requirements, troubleshooting history, design limitations, and optimal system performance targets. With support from internal and external expertise, develop, implement and maintain a certified QMS to ISO 9001:2015. Support Production Part Approval Process (PPAP) and Part Submission Warrant (PSW) preparation. Work with Manufacturing and Engineering teams to develop and revise effective procedures that comply with ISO 9001:2015 QMS requirements while maintaining lean operations. Provide training and support to operations personnel in all aspects of quality. Review user documentation to ensure that required warnings, labels and symbols are properly documented as required by standards. Support Engineering FMEA initiatives with collection of KPI data on critical design features. Participate in complaint investigations, failure analysis of returned products, and issues resulting in a stop ship/stop production; document findings, provide reports and analysis; apply root cause analyses using 5Why, Fishbone diagrams etc.; drive implementation of solutions to prevent recurrence of root causes. Execute and document supplier non‑conformance reports Supplier Corrective Actions (SCARs) and Corrective and Preventative Actions (CAPAs). Develop inspection plans for incoming material, ensuring parts are inspected per AQL. Work cross functionally with Engineering to evaluate and improve inspection processes and tooling designs through data analysis and feedback loops, aiming for enhanced productivity and quality assurance. Ensure appropriate critical characteristics (per latest Plug procedure EN-0010) cascade in the Process Monitoring Forms as needed to enable compliance to safety, performance and durability product targets. Ensure Production Equipment and Tooling are maintained in the Calibration program. Ensure tooling and equipment is scheduled for calibration at defined intervals. Ensure calibration records are properly maintained. Monitor, communicate and improve key Quality KPIs, DPPM and waste. Support in complaint investigations, failure analysis of returned products, and issues resulting in a stop ship/stop production; document findings, provide reports and analysis; apply root cause analyses using 5Why, Fishbone diagrams etc.; drive implementation of solutions to prevent recurrence of root causes. Develop and lead in‑process inspection capabilities. Lead Material Review Board discussions , determining product dispositions for nonconforming material. Work directly with Quality and Engineering team members to develop and qualify inspection, monitoring, and verification methods. Conduct rigorous Continuous Improvement activities to prevent recurrence of non‑conformances during assembly. Perform internal audit activities to ensure compliance to QMS requirements. Build relationships and engage in regular communications with cross‑functional colleagues. Represent Plug Power in a professional manner at all times and in all interactions. Perform all other duties as assigned.

Education and Experience

BS in Engineering or a STEM related discipline 3-5 years’ experience working in Engineering Computer and software systems skills as applicable to position including but not limited to: Word, PowerPoint, Excel, and Outlook Experience with ISO 9001:2015 or ISO13485 and other recognized international quality system standards. Knowledge of engineering change process. Strong verbal and written communication skills Demonstrated analytical abilities with strong attention to detail Ability to manage multiple projects concurrently. Ability to read and interpret engineering diagrams. Ability to role model high standards of professionalism with an uncompromising dedication to quality design & documentation and operational safety. Knowledge of quality system methodologies including 8D, Lean, 5 Why’s, Pareto Analysis, Six Sigma, 8-D. Knowledge with implementation Statistical Process Controls, applying Failure Modes Effects Analysis (FMEA), Production Part Approval Process (PPAP) and root cause analysis are a plus. Strong problem‑solving skills. Strong organizational skills. Project management skills. Attention to detail. Travel as needed to accomplish program objectives.
